Name of the Condition
- Type 2 Diabetes Mellitus (ICD-10 Code: E11)
Summary
Type 2 diabetes mellitus is a chronic metabolic disorder characterized by insulin resistance and relative insulin deficiency, leading to elevated blood glucose levels. It is the most common form of diabetes and often develops gradually over time, requiring ongoing management to prevent complications.
Causes
The condition arises from a combination of genetic and lifestyle factors that impair the body's ability to use insulin effectively or produce sufficient insulin. Insulin resistance, where cells do not respond properly to insulin, and inadequate insulin secretion by the pancreas are primary mechanisms.
Risk Factors
- Age: Risk increases with age, particularly after 45.
- Obesity: Excess body weight, especially abdominal fat, is a major risk factor.
- Physical inactivity: Sedentary lifestyles contribute to insulin resistance.
- Family history: A genetic predisposition increases susceptibility.
- Ethnicity: Higher prevalence in African American, Hispanic, Native American, and Asian populations.
- Gestational diabetes: History of diabetes during pregnancy raises future risk.
Symptoms
- Increased thirst (polydipsia) and frequent urination (polyuria).
- Unexplained weight loss or gain, fatigue, and blurred vision.
- Slow-healing sores, frequent infections, and tingling in hands or feet.
- Increased hunger (polyphagia) and dry mouth.
Diagnosis
Diagnosis is confirmed through blood tests, including fasting plasma glucose, HbA1c, and oral glucose tolerance tests. Clinical evaluation assesses symptoms, risk factors, and may include additional tests to rule out other conditions or detect complications.
Treatment Options
Management focuses on lifestyle modifications, such as a balanced diet and regular exercise, to improve insulin sensitivity. Medications like metformin, sulfonylureas, or injectable therapies may be prescribed to control blood glucose. Regular monitoring and personalized treatment plans are essential.
Prognosis and Follow-Up
With proper management, individuals can lead healthy lives, but long-term complications may develop if blood sugar is not controlled. Regular follow-up appointments, including HbA1c testing and screenings for complications, are critical for maintaining health and adjusting treatment as needed.
Complications
Uncontrolled diabetes can lead to cardiovascular disease, kidney damage (nephropathy), nerve damage (neuropathy), eye problems (retinopathy), and increased infection risk. Foot ulcers and amputations may occur due to poor circulation and nerve damage.
Lifestyle & Prevention
- Maintain a healthy weight through diet and exercise.
- Limit processed foods, sugars, and saturated fats.
- Engage in at least 150 minutes of moderate activity weekly.
- Monitor blood glucose levels as advised by a healthcare provider.
- Avoid smoking and limit alcohol consumption.
When to Seek Professional Help
Seek medical attention if experiencing symptoms like excessive thirst, frequent urination, unexplained weight loss, or fatigue. Immediate care is needed for signs of hyperglycemia (e.g., confusion, rapid breathing) or hypoglycemia (e.g., dizziness, sweating).
Tips for Medical Coders
Document the diagnosis clearly, including any specified or unspecified complications. Ensure coding aligns with clinical documentation, as E11 is used for Type 2 diabetes without further specification. Verify that supporting documentation justifies the code and reflects the patient's current condition.
